    Round 7

    Abril is now on the front-foot, missing right hooks from too far out and following with the left cross up top. Hogan is jogging in reverse, able to comfortably reach Abril with long counters downstairs & up. Everything from Hogan, whether leading or countering, straight & in multiples. Abril is now the one chasing and missing as Hogan swerves past him on the carousel, using quick feet and showing good stamina. Abril falling short with the right jab and backed up by a pair of long clubbing rights by Hogan, both partially blocked.

    10-9 Hogan

    68-65 Hogan

    Round 8

    Abril is getting swarmed and forced to battle in close. Hogan is missing a lot of punches over Abril's back, threshing with both hands repeatedly in continuous light motions without much snap. Abril eats a left hook while pushing Hogan into a backpedal and manages to respond with a grazing right hook on Hogan's temple. Abril is staying low and shoving his bodyweight into Hogan to drive him away in straight lines, directly in the path of Abril's right hooks on the body.

    10-9 Abril

    77-75 Hogan

    Round 9

    Abril is waving his right jab up at Hogan, sashaying in and then quickly retreating, up on his toes. Hogan is carrying Abril into the ropes and trading body thumps with him. Trading hooks, Abril scores up top with the right while Hogan lands downstairs with the left, their arms colliding and muting the effectiveness of either punch. Abril dives into a low clinch and Hogan clubs him across the back with his right arm.

    10-9 Hogan, extremely close

    87-84 Hogan

    Round 10

    Abril is running in place after each sortie, getting the blood flowing to his legs, stalling, thinking out his next move. Hogan is moving in and out throwing underhanded combos on the belt line. Abril is unable to find him with a counter punch and is just loading up hoping for one. Finally a right hand on the button, catching Hogan blundering in and backing him up, but Hogan immediately recovers and is still the one setting the pace. Two-way flurry in the final ten seconds, good action, not much landing crisply.

    10-9 Hogan

    97-93 Hogan
